The Oscar-winning film starring Jennifer Lawrence, Bradley Cooper, and Robert DeNiro is set for Blu-Ray and DVD release tomorrow. Like most films, the Blu-Rays and DVDs are complete with bonus features. Most of these features include behind-the-scenes footage, deleted scenes and such, but in rare occasions, you get to see an alternate ending. Though Silver Linings Playbook has warranted a lot of praise and concluded in a nice, poignant way, director David O. Russell had a different ending in mind. (SPOILERS to follow)

This film centers on Bradley Cooper's character, Pat Solitano Jr., after being released from a mental health facility for bipolar disorder treatment. He eventually makes friends with Tiffany Maxwell (Jennifer Lawrence), which leads to a dancing competition and eventually a romance. There is also a lot of Eagles football and gambling (thanks to Robert DeNiro).

The film was a huge success and garnered Oscar nominations as well as a win for Jennifer Lawrence. It was a pleasant story that had its ups and downs but ultimately came to a crowd-pleasing conclusion. But the director might have wanted an even "nicer" ending, which is evident in the alternate ending.
